Understanding Your Options
Metal Roofing
Metal roofing has become increasingly popular in Orlando and throughout Florida in recent years. Made from materials like aluminum, steel, copper, or zinc alloys, metal roofs are known for their exceptional durability and longevity, especially in our hurricane-prone region.
Architectural Shingles
Architectural shingles (also called dimensional or laminated shingles) are a premium type of asphalt shingle. They’re thicker than traditional 3-tab shingles and designed to add depth and texture to your roof while providing improved durability.
How They Compare: The Key Factors
1. Lifespan and Durability
Metal Roofing:
- Expected lifespan in Florida: 40-70 years
- Withstands hurricane-force winds (many are rated for 140-180 mph)
- Highly resistant to fire, mildew, insects, and rot
- Won’t crack, warp, or corrode with proper installation and maintenance
- Can handle extreme weather conditions, including Florida’s intense sun and heavy rains
Architectural Shingles:
- Expected lifespan in Florida: 12-17 years (significantly shorter than in cooler climates)
- Wind resistance typically between 110-130 mph
- Good fire resistance, but vulnerable to mold and mildew over time
- Can curl, crack, or lose granules due to Florida’s intense heat and humidity
- May require more frequent repairs, especially after severe storms
2. Cost Considerations
Metal Roofing:
- Initial installation: $9.00-$17.00 per square foot
- Average cost for 2,000 sq ft roof: $18,000-$34,000
- Higher upfront investment, but often more cost-effective long-term
- May reduce insurance premiums due to superior durability
- Minimal maintenance costs over its lifetime
Architectural Shingles:
- Initial installation: $5.25-$7.50 per square foot
- Average cost for 2,000 sq ft roof: $10,500-$15,000
- More affordable upfront, but may cost more long-term due to earlier replacement
- Standard insurance rates in most cases
- More frequent maintenance and potential repairs
3. Energy Efficiency
Metal Roofing:
- Reflects solar radiant heat rather than absorbing it
- Can reduce cooling costs by 10-25% during hot Orlando summers
- Many qualify for Energy Star certification
- Some coatings can further enhance energy efficiency
- Solar reflectance keeps your home cooler naturally
Architectural Shingles:
- Absorbs heat, which can transfer into your attic and living spaces
- Standard colors offer limited solar reflectance
- Some “cool roof” shingle options available but less effective than metal
- May contribute to higher cooling costs in summer months
- Less energy efficient overall in Florida’s climate
4. Aesthetics and Curb Appeal
Metal Roofing:
- Contemporary, distinctive appearance
- Available in a wide range of colors, finishes, and styles
- Can mimic other materials including tile, slate, or wood shake
- Maintains its appearance for decades with minimal fading
- Increasingly popular in Orlando neighborhoods
Architectural Shingles:
- Traditional, classic look that complements many home styles
- Dimensional texture adds visual interest and depth
- Wide variety of color options to match your home’s exterior
- May show algae streaks in Florida’s humid climate
- Familiar appearance that many homeowners prefer
5. Installation Factors
Metal Roofing:
- Installation time: 3-7 days for average homes
- Requires specialized skills and equipment
- Less waste during installation
- Can sometimes be installed over existing roofing (weight-dependent)
- Higher labor costs due to expertise required
Architectural Shingles:
- Installation time: 1-3 days for most homes
- More contractors available with necessary skills
- Simpler installation process
- Often requires complete removal of old roofing
- More affordable labor costs
6. Environmental Impact
Metal Roofing:
- 100% recyclable at end of life
- Often made with significant recycled content
- Minimal landfill impact
- Energy-efficient properties reduce carbon footprint
- Can serve as an excellent base for solar panel installation
Architectural Shingles:
- Petroleum-based product that eventually ends up in landfills
- Limited recycling options currently available
- Shorter lifespan means more frequent disposal
- Manufacturing process has higher environmental impact
- Less ideal for solar panel installation due to shorter lifespan

What’s Right for Your Orlando Home?
The best choice depends on your specific situation:
Consider metal roofing if:
- You plan to stay in your home long-term
- Energy efficiency is a priority
- You live in an area frequently affected by high winds or storms
- You’re looking for the most durable, long-lasting option
- Environmental impact matters to you
- You can accommodate the higher upfront investment
Consider architectural shingles if:
- You have budget constraints for your initial investment
- You plan to sell your home in the next 5-10 years
- You prefer a traditional aesthetic
- You need a quicker installation timeframe
- You’re looking for a good mid-range option
